The "Blaster" screensaver crashes my system every time.  I'm running an
S3 Savage video on Debian Woody (2.4.19).  After disabling that screen
saver no more crashes, also able to get it to crash by running it in
demo mode.  Have also seen references to others having this problem with
this screensaver.  Some sort of bug in XFree 86.
